Hello Everyone,

I was wondering if you can help me with something I have been working on. I currently have 3 tables in one base. One table has different names of clients (Table 1). The other table has the names of projects they are attached to with a record ID through a formula (Table 2). In Table 1, I have a linked record column to link each client to a project and there is a lookup column as well that shows the record ID of the project. Finally the 3rd table is used to store data from a form. In the form, I want to be able to have a linked record (select a client from Table 1), but I want to filter the options in the form under the linked record, so when filling out the form for one project, only clients linked to the project will show up as an option, so this could be a filter by the recordID of the project if that makes sense. Views will not work for my use because Airtable does not have a way to dynamically filter the view by different record ID's without creating a new form/view for each project. If this is not possible in Airtable, I can also add URL parameters to embed in my website as well since this is a form, that I plan on embedding. Any assistance would be greatly appreciated! 2025 Update:

This is now natively supported in Airtable using dynamic filtering in linked record fields.
